Curt Jones – 360 Degrees

He was born in Newark, New Jersey, in 1957 & came from a highly trained musical family. Not only was his Grandfather, Hershel Davenport, a Big Band Leader, His Aunts recorded as The Davenport Sisters for Motown. He became a member of the Symphonic Express & he had been the …

Acoustic Alchemy – This Way

With the release of “This Way”, Acoustic Alchemy’s first album under Higher Octave/Narada Jazz’s association with Blue Note Records, guitarists Greg Carmichael and Miles Gilderdale celebrate a remarkable two decades since 1987’s Red Dust and Spanish Lace established the British ensemble as an ever evolving, powerhouse force in contemporary jazz. …

Marc Antoine – Hi-Lo Split

By Terrill Hanna
 
The Guitarist from the exotic jazz journey returns….
 
From Madrid to Los Angeles, Mr. Marc Antoine still walks & grooves to the funky, bossa nova beat. His flow naturally comes off organic with an R&B interest. The title name to his new CD? It came from a victory shared at the card playing table. With that breath of excitement, he learned that winning on a ‘Hi-Lo Split’ easily meant winning with the highest & Lowest hand! Will his latest project “Hi-Lo Split” become a winners choice for you?
